摘要
A graphene oxide nanosheets/multi-walled carbon nanotubes (GO/MWCNTs) hybrid with excellent electrocatalytic redox reversibility towards VO2+/VO2+ redox couples for vanadium redox flow batteries (VRFB) has been prepared by an electrostatic spray technique after efficient ultrasonic treatment. The structures and electrochemical properties of GO/MWCNTs are investigated by transmission electron microscopy, scanning electron microscopy, X-ray diffraction, X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y, Raman spectroscopy and cyclic voltammetry. GO/MWCNTs are shown to be cross-linked and form an electrocatalytic hybrid with an effective mixed conducting network, leading to efficiently fast ion and electron transport characteristics. Compared with the pure GO nanosheets and MWCNTs, GO/MWCNTs deliver a much better electrocatalytic redox reversibility towards the positive VO2+/VO2+ couple, especially for the reduction from VO2+ to VO2+. The excellent experimental results demonstrate that the newly developed hybrid material holds great promise in the application of VRFB.
